My best advice to you is to get her to an Epilepsy Center which are usually at University hospitals and have her see a neurologist or even better a Epileptologist (Dr. specializing in epilepsy) I've had seizures for 37 yrs. and they have found that often times when a person has heart problems and there's not a good flow of blood to the brain it will sometimes cause seizures. Your aunt should have an e.e.g., MRI, CT scan, and also have stress test to see if her heart problem is causing her seizures.
